When does BRCO11 pay the next dividend?

  • 2026-06 — Mercado Livre Bresco Bahia renewal (decision expected): Active renegotiation underway. Base case: renewal with IPCA adjustment (~75% probability). Tail case: total exit (~15% probability) or renewal with a rent reduction (~10%).
  • 2026-09 — Full lease of Bresco Embu (advanced talks): Management reports advanced discussions for the full lease of Bresco Embu (currently 100% vacant, 7,629 sqm + 14,084 sqm of yard = 3.7% of fund GLA). 2.0x the vacant area in the pipeline.
  • 2026-12 — Partial lease in Canoas (16k sqm in preliminary talks): Preliminary discussions to occupy ~16k sqm at Bresco Canoas (0.9x the vacant area). Potential addition with rent close to Rio Grande do Sul market levels.
  • 2027-12 — Natura HUB Itupeva maturity (atypical lease): Atypical lease for Natura HUB Itupeva (34.8k sqm) matures in Dec/2028 (remaining term 2.7 years). Renewal expected given investment in automation and build-to-suit — but requires monitoring.
  • 2028-12 — Monetization of Viracopos expansion (15% potential GLA): Expansion potential of 90k sqm at Viracopos (15% of the fund's current GLA). Construction decision requires a new offering or internal generation. Estimated cap rate ~9%.

Income analysis

DPU rose from R$ 0.87 (2024-2025 regime) to R$ 0.95 (May/2026) with the entry of new leases. Positive trend maintained until stabilization at R$ 0.95-1.00 in 2H26.

Are the dividends sustainable?

The fund is on a positive trend: DPU maintained at R$ 0.95 with Embu vacancy confirmed cleared (Expresso 3300, May/26). Cash balance at the end of May/26 at R$ 68.1M. Undistributed retained cash earnings of R$ 35.7M (R$ 1.98/unit) serve as a meaningful buffer. Note: Viracopos G1 expires in ~June/2027 (1.0 remaining year); renewal is the next key event alongside Mercado Livre in Bahia.

Distribution guidance

For 2026 — 2nd half, the manager projects a distribution of R$ 0.92 to R$ 0.98 per unit per month.

Will BRCO11 keep the dividend?

DPU rose from R$ 0.87 to R$ 0.95 between Jan and May/26 (+9%) with new Nubank, M. Dias Branco, Reckitt expansion, FedEx addendum, and Viracopos rent guarantees. Positive trend maintained.
